如何设计栅格

设计栅格时,首先确定页面布局需求,选择合适的栅格系统(如12列或16列)。其次,定义栅格的宽度和间距,确保响应式设计。使用CSS框架如Bootstrap可简化过程。最后,通过视觉一致性测试,确保栅格在不同设备上的表现一致。

imagesource from: pexels

引言:探索栅格设计在网页设计中的重要性

在数字化时代,网页设计已成为传达信息、提升用户体验的关键。其中,栅格设计作为网页布局的基础,扮演着举足轻重的角色。本文将带您深入了解栅格设计的重要性,简述栅格系统的基本概念及其对用户体验和页面布局的影响,激发读者对栅格设计的兴趣。

栅格系统,顾名思义,是一种以规则网格为基础的布局方式。它将页面划分为多个等比例的矩形区域,为网页内容和元素提供有序的排列空间。在网页设计中,合理运用栅格系统可以提升页面布局的整齐度,优化用户体验,使信息传递更加高效。

随着互联网技术的不断发展,栅格设计在网页设计中的应用越来越广泛。它不仅有助于设计师快速搭建页面结构,还能保证页面在不同设备上的显示效果。因此,掌握栅格设计的基本概念和技巧,对于设计师来说至关重要。

在接下来的文章中,我们将详细探讨如何设计栅格,包括确定页面布局需求、定义栅格的宽度和间距、使用CSS框架以及进行视觉一致性测试等关键步骤。通过学习这些内容,您将能够更好地运用栅格设计,为用户提供高质量的网页体验。

一、确定页面布局需求

在设计栅格时,首先要明确页面布局的需求,这关乎到用户体验和页面的整体视觉效果。以下是确定页面布局需求的关键步骤:

1. 分析页面内容和功能需求

页面内容和功能是布局设计的核心。深入了解页面要展示的信息和用户交互方式,有助于合理划分主要内容和辅助内容的布局。

  • 主要信息:页面的核心内容,通常占据主要展示位置。
  • 辅助信息:辅助性内容,如导航、广告、侧边栏等。

2. 确定主要内容和辅助内容的布局

根据分析结果,划分页面布局的区域。主要内容包括标题、文章、图片等,辅助内容则包括导航、侧边栏、广告等。

主要内容 辅助内容
文章主体 导航
图片轮播 广告
视频播放 侧边栏

3. 选择合适的栅格系统(12列或16列)

栅格系统是网页设计中的骨架,它帮助我们将页面内容划分为多个网格单元。选择合适的栅格系统可以简化设计过程,提高效率。

  • 12列栅格系统:适合中小型网站,布局灵活。
  • 16列栅格系统:适合大型网站,结构稳定。

在实际应用中,可以根据具体需求和页面风格选择合适的栅格系统。

二、定义栅格的宽度和间距

1. 设定栅格的基本宽度

在栅格设计中,设定栅格的基本宽度是至关重要的第一步。这直接影响到整个页面的布局和视觉效果。通常,栅格的宽度取决于内容需求和设计风格。例如,在网页设计中,常见的栅格宽度为120px、160px或180px。选择合适的宽度有助于保持内容的可读性和美观性。

2. 确定栅格间距及其对视觉的影响

栅格间距是指栅格与栅格之间的距离,它对整个页面的视觉效果有着重要影响。合理的间距可以使页面看起来更加整洁、有序。在确定栅格间距时,需要考虑以下因素:

  • 视觉层次:通过调整栅格间距,可以突出显示重点内容,提高视觉层次感。
  • 响应式设计:在不同的屏幕尺寸下,栅格间距需要适应变化,以保持良好的视觉效果。
  • 内容布局:根据内容的需求,适当调整栅格间距,使页面布局更加合理。

3. 考虑不同屏幕尺寸的适应性

随着移动设备的普及,响应式设计已成为网页设计的必备要素。在定义栅格的宽度和间距时,需要考虑不同屏幕尺寸的适应性。以下是一些常见的方法:

  • 百分比布局:使用百分比设置栅格宽度和间距,可以保证在不同屏幕尺寸下保持良好的视觉效果。
  • 媒体查询:通过媒体查询,针对不同屏幕尺寸调整栅格的宽度和间距,实现响应式设计。
  • 框架辅助:利用CSS框架(如Bootstrap)提供的相关类,可以快速实现栅格的响应式设计。

通过以上步骤,可以有效地定义栅格的宽度和间距,为后续的页面布局和设计奠定基础。在实际操作中,需要根据具体的项目需求和设计风格进行调整,以达到最佳效果。

三、使用CSS框架简化设计

在网页设计中,使用CSS框架如Bootstrap可以大大简化栅格系统的搭建过程。以下是对CSS框架的介绍、如何利用框架快速搭建栅格系统以及框架的优势和局限性。

1. 介绍常用的CSS框架(如Bootstrap)

CSS框架是一种预定义的CSS样式表,它包含了各种常用的UI组件和设计模式。Bootstrap是最受欢迎的CSS框架之一,它提供了响应式布局、栅格系统、表单控件、按钮、图像、下拉菜单等丰富的组件,使得开发者可以快速构建美观、响应式且功能齐全的网页。

2. 如何利用框架快速搭建栅格系统

利用CSS框架搭建栅格系统非常简单。以下以Bootstrap为例,介绍如何快速搭建栅格系统:

  1. 引入Bootstrap的CSS文件:在HTML文档的部分引入Bootstrap的CSS文件,确保页面可以正常使用Bootstrap的样式。
  1. 定义栅格容器:在需要使用栅格系统的区域,添加一个.container类,确保栅格系统在容器内部正确显示。
  1. 定义栅格行:在.container内部,添加一个.row类,表示一个栅格行。
  1. 定义栅格列:在.row内部,添加一个.col-*类,其中*代表栅格列的宽度,例如.col-md-6表示在中等设备上占据一半宽度。

3. 框架的优势和局限性

优势

  • 提高开发效率:CSS框架提供了丰富的组件和样式,开发者可以快速构建网页,节省时间和精力。
  • 响应式设计:CSS框架通常支持响应式设计,使网页在不同设备上具有良好的兼容性和视觉效果。
  • 一致性:CSS框架保证了网页元素的一致性,提升用户体验。

局限性

  • 性能:CSS框架通常包含大量样式和组件,可能导致页面加载速度变慢。
  • 定制性:使用CSS框架时,可能需要调整样式以满足特定需求,这可能会增加开发难度。
  • 学习成本:对于初学者来说,学习CSS框架可能需要一定的时间和精力。

四、视觉一致性测试

在栅格设计过程中,进行视觉一致性测试至关重要。以下是几个关键步骤,以确保栅格在不同设备上的表现一致。

1. 测试栅格在不同设备上的表现

首先,我们需要在多种设备上测试栅格的表现。这包括桌面电脑、平板电脑和智能手机。通过查看栅格在不同分辨率和屏幕尺寸下的布局,我们可以确保栅格在不同设备上保持一致。

设备类型 屏幕尺寸 栅格表现
桌面电脑 1920×1080 栅格布局正常
平板电脑 1024×768 栅格布局正常
智能手机 360×640 栅格布局正常

2. 确保栅格系统的响应式设计

响应式设计是栅格设计的重要部分。我们需要确保栅格在不同屏幕尺寸下都能自适应。以下是一些常用的响应式设计技巧:

  • 使用百分比宽度代替固定宽度;
  • 使用媒体查询来调整栅格列数和间距;
  • 为不同屏幕尺寸定义不同的栅格系统。

3. 调整和优化栅格布局

在测试过程中,可能会发现一些布局问题。这时,我们需要对栅格布局进行调整和优化。以下是一些常见的调整方法:

  • 调整栅格列数和间距;
  • 优化内容排版,使页面更美观;
  • 使用CSS框架提供的辅助类来简化布局。

通过以上步骤,我们可以确保栅格在不同设备上的表现一致,从而提升用户体验。

结语:栅格设计的未来趋势

在总结栅格设计的关键步骤和注意事项后,我们不禁要展望栅格设计在未来的发展趋势。随着技术的不断进步和用户需求的变化,栅格设计将呈现出以下几大趋势:

  1. 智能化和自动化:随着AI技术的发展,栅格设计将更加智能化和自动化。设计工具将能够根据内容自动生成栅格布局,提高设计效率。

  2. 个性化定制:未来,用户将更加注重个性化体验。栅格设计将更加灵活,允许用户根据自己的需求进行定制,实现个性化的页面布局。

  3. 跨平台融合:随着移动设备和物联网的普及,栅格设计将更加注重跨平台融合。设计师需要考虑到不同设备上的用户体验,实现无缝切换。

  4. 视觉效果优化:视觉效果在栅格设计中占据重要地位。未来,设计师将更加注重视觉效果,通过栅格布局实现更丰富的视觉层次和视觉效果。

  5. 响应式设计:随着屏幕尺寸和分辨率的多样化,响应式设计将成为栅格设计的必然趋势。设计师需要考虑不同屏幕尺寸下的栅格布局,确保用户体验的一致性。

总之,栅格设计在未来将继续发挥重要作用,为网页设计带来更多的可能性。鼓励读者在实际项目中应用栅格系统,不断探索和创新,为用户带来更好的视觉体验。

常见问题

1、什么是栅格系统?

栅格系统是一种在网页设计中用于组织页面布局的工具,它通过规则的网格结构将页面分为多个区块,帮助设计师在布局时保持一致的视觉风格和结构。

2、如何选择合适的栅格列数?

选择栅格列数主要取决于页面内容和设计风格。常见的栅格列数有12列和16列。12列栅格适用于内容较多的页面,16列栅格则更适合内容较少或追求简洁风格的页面。

3、栅格设计对响应式布局有何影响?

栅格设计有助于实现响应式布局,通过调整栅格的列宽和间距,可以使页面在不同设备上保持良好的视觉体验和功能表现。

4、使用CSS框架有哪些注意事项?

使用CSS框架可以简化设计过程,但在使用过程中需要注意以下几点:

  • 确保框架的版本与项目兼容;
  • 根据实际需求定制框架样式,避免过度依赖默认样式;
  • 注意框架的性能影响,避免影响页面加载速度。

5、如何进行栅格的视觉一致性测试?

进行视觉一致性测试时,可以通过以下步骤:

  • 在不同设备上预览页面,观察栅格布局和元素位置;
  • 检查页面在不同屏幕尺寸下的响应效果;
  • 对栅格布局进行微调,确保其在各种设备上表现一致。

原创文章,作者:路飞练拳的地方,如若转载,请注明出处:https://www.shuziqianzhan.com/article/39061.html

(0)
上一篇 2小时前
下一篇 2小时前

相关推荐

  • 如何设计电商平台

    设计电商平台需关注用户体验、界面简洁、功能完善。首先,明确目标用户群体,定制个性化推荐。其次,优化搜索和导航,确保商品易找。最后,强化支付安全和客户服务,提升信任度。

  • 如何查看网站域名解析

    要查看网站域名解析,首先访问域名注册商的控制面板,找到域名管理或DNS设置。在此处查看A记录、CNAME记录等,了解域名指向的具体IP地址或别名。也可以使用在线DNS查询工具如MXToolbox,输入域名即可查看解析详情。

  • xlsx如何查重

    在Excel中查重非常简单。首先,选中需要查重的数据列,点击菜单栏的“数据”选项卡,选择“删除重复项”。在弹出的窗口中,勾选需要查重的列,点击“确定”即可自动删除重复数据。此外,还可以使用条件格式功能,通过“开始”选项卡中的“条件格式”->“突出显示单元格规则”->“重复值”,快速标记重复数据。

  • 如何控制网站

    控制网站需从基础做起:首先,确保网站安全,使用强密码和SSL证书;其次,定期更新内容和软件,保持网站活力;最后,利用SEO优化提升排名,吸引更多流量。通过这些步骤,有效掌握网站运营。

  • 如何注册 xyz

    注册xyz非常简单,只需三步:首先,访问xyz官网;其次,点击注册按钮,填写必要信息如邮箱、密码;最后,验证邮箱即可激活账户。注意阅读服务条款,确保信息准确无误。

  • 前端如何排版

    前端排版关键在于简洁明了。使用CSS框架如Bootstrap快速布局,善用Flexbox和Grid系统实现响应式设计。合理利用HTML标签,确保语义化,提升SEO效果。通过CSS样式表统一字体、颜色和间距,保持界面一致性。注重代码可读性,使用注释和模块化开发,提升团队协作效率。

  • css如何做渐变

    CSS实现渐变主要有两种方式:线性渐变和径向渐变。线性渐变使用`linear-gradient`函数,语法为`linear-gradient(direction, color1, color2, …)`,其中`direction`可以是角度或关键字如`to bottom`。例如,`background-image: linear-gradient(to right, red, blue);`表示从红到蓝的水平渐变。径向渐变则使用`radial-gradient`函数,语法为`radial-gradient(shape size at position, color1, color2, …)`,如`background-image: radial-gradient(circle at center, yellow, green);`表示从黄到绿的圆形渐变。

  • 如何优化seo搜索引擎

    优化SEO搜索引擎的关键在于关键词研究、内容质量和链接建设。首先,通过工具如Google Keyword Planner进行关键词研究,选取高搜索量且竞争适中的关键词。其次,确保内容原创、有价值且包含目标关键词。最后,通过内外链策略提升网站权威性,利用社交媒体和 guest blogging 增加反向链接。

  • 网站如何配置域名

    配置域名是网站上线的关键步骤。首先,购买域名后,进入域名管理后台,找到DNS解析设置。添加A记录或CNAME记录,指向你的服务器IP或主机名。确保记录类型和值正确无误。随后,在网站服务器配置中绑定该域名。等待DNS解析生效,一般需24小时。检查配置是否成功,可使用ping命令测试域名解析情况。

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注